Hybrid Hardware in Loop Architecture for Autonomous Vehicles

© 2024 by IJCTT Journal
Volume-72 Issue-7
Year of Publication : 2024
Authors : Shobhit Kukreti, Tanvi Hungund, Priyank Singh
DOI :  10.14445/22312803/IJCTT-V72I7P104

How to Cite?

Shobhit Kukreti, Tanvi Hungund, Priyank Singh, "Hybrid Hardware in Loop Architecture for Autonomous Vehicles," International Journal of Computer Trends and Technology, vol. 72, no. 7, pp. 26-31, 2024. Crossref, https://doi.org/10.14445/22312803/IJCTT-V72I7P104

The automotive world is going through a paradigm shift. With sensor technologies like 4K cameras, LiDARs, Radars, etc., becoming more affordable and advances in Deep Learning algorithms development, research is trending towards developing Autonomous Vehicles and bringing them mainstream. However, a challenge remains in the commercialization of technologies. An automotive vehicle undergoes a rigorous verification and validation model. Perfected over decades, standards and guidelines are introduced to minimize failures. However, there exists a gap in testing when working with new sensors and algorithms, and our paper focuses on a hybrid setup for hardware in loop testing, which enables software to iterate over their development faster without having to wait to deploy on actual cars for testing.

Autonomous Vehicles, Linux, Operating System, Emulation, QEMU.


[1] Jayshri Sudhir Potdar, and Yashwant B Mane, “Hardware Design and Development of Engine Control Unit for Four Cylinder Engine,” 2018 Fourth International Conference on Computing Communication Control and Automation, Pune, India, pp. 1-5, 2018.
[CrossRef] [Google Scholar] [Publisher Link]
[2] Run apps on the Android Emulato, Developers. [Online]. Available: https://developer.android.com/studio/run/emulator
[3] QEMU. [Online]. Available: qemu.org
[4] BOCHS. [Online]. Available: https://bochs.sourceforge.io/
[5] RENODE. [Online]. Available: https://renode.io/
[6] dSPACE HIL. [Online]. Available: https://www.dspace.com/
[7] Debootstrap. [Online]. Available: https://wiki.debian.org/Debootstrap
[8] Debian. [Online]. Available: https://www.debian.org/
[9] Linux Kernel. [Online]. Available: https://www.kernel.org/
[10] Buildroot. [Online]. Available: https://buildroot.org/
[11] ARM64. [Online]. Available: https://en.wikipedia.org/wiki/AArch64
[12] CARLA. [Online]. Available: https://carla.org/
[13] Kainan Wang, Gigabit Multimedia Serial Link (GMSL) Cameras as an Alternative to GigE Vision Cameras, Analog Devices, 2023. [Online]. Available: https://www.analog.com/en/resources/analog-dialogue/articles/gigabit-multimedia-serial-link-gmsl-cameras.html
[14] Devmem. [Online]. Available: https://trac.gateworks.com/wiki/linux/devmem